Output de33a368c1112307f1e47a6660044a72ee775ee662ef33acd0a645262f49f153:0

value
54560
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e477820bbfd2c8bbc6d74687d2fb64f566e0adbd OP_EQUAL
address
3NX39qnWDnxJkb6A6qPVsn1sfUn9u4QJoR
transaction
de33a368c1112307f1e47a6660044a72ee775ee662ef33acd0a645262f49f153
confirmations
177870
spent
true